Fox News Poll: Marijuana Legalization Support Hits Record High

Cannabis Poll

Recreational marijuana is legal in 9 states and Washington D.C., and a new Fox News Poll has found that a record number of American voters now favor legalization.

The poll indicates that 59% of voters support marijuana legalization, which represents an 8% increase from 2015 and 13% from 2013, Fox News reports. Opposition to legalization decreased from 49% in 2013 to 32% in 2018.

Chris Anderson, who conducted the poll in partnership with Daron Shaw, said, “This is a massive shift in opinion over a very short period. As more states legalize marijuana without the negative consequences opponents have warned about, support will likely continue to increase.”

The poll also found that 72% of millennials support legalization compared to 60% of Gen-Xers and 52% of Baby Boomers.

68% of Democrats and 67% of Independents support legalization, while Republicans were at 46%. Overall, 59% of politicians favor legalization.

61% of very conservative voters and 53% of white evangelical Christians still oppose legalization. The opposition in those groups is down previous polls.

Shaw said, “When you look at the growing percentage of people who say they support legalizing marijuana, especially among those under 30 years of age, it’s obvious why the Democrats are anxious to get pot initiatives on the ballot in statewide elections.”
